Thank you for your interest in the Disaster Response Crisis Counselor program. To become a certified DRCC you must follow the 4 steps listed below. The expectation is that this process will be completed within 2 years. Certification is for 2 years from initial certification.

2. Trainings you must have for the DRCC certificate:

You must complete the four required trainings listed below to apply to become a Disaster Response Crisis Counselor. Necessary Trainings:
1. Introduction to Disaster Behavioral Health and Crisis Counseling
2. National Incident Management System (NIMS 700) /Incident Command System (ICS 100) Note: NIMS and ICS training can be taken on-line.
3. Cultural and Ethical Issues in Disaster Response and Recovery
4. Psychological First Aid

Re-Certification Requirements

Once you receive your DRCC Certification, you are required to complete 12 hours of continuing education credits / response hours every two years in order to maintain the certification.
